So, what exactly is an employee 360 survey? This type of survey involves gathering feedback from an employee’s peers, managers, subordinates, and even themselves. The idea behind this comprehensive approach is to gain a well-rounded view of an employee’s strengths, weaknesses, and areas for improvement.

There are several key benefits to conducting an employee 360 survey in your business.

First and foremost, an employee 360 survey can help to boost employee engagement and morale. When employees feel like their opinions are valued and listened to, they are more likely to be engaged in their work and motivated to perform to the best of their abilities. This can lead to improved productivity, higher job satisfaction, and lower turnover rates within the organization.

Additionally, an employee 360 survey can provide valuable insights into potential areas for improvement within the company. By gathering feedback from multiple sources, businesses can identify common themes, patterns, and issues that may be hindering employee performance or satisfaction. This information can then be used to make strategic changes and improvements to the work environment, processes, or policies.

Furthermore, conducting an employee 360 survey can help to promote a culture of transparency and open communication within the organization. By encouraging feedback from all levels of the company, employees are more likely to feel comfortable speaking up about their concerns, providing constructive criticism, and sharing their ideas for improvement. This can lead to a more positive and collaborative work environment where everyone feels heard and valued.

Another key benefit of an employee 360 survey is that it can help to identify and develop future leaders within the organization. By gathering feedback from peers, managers, and subordinates, businesses can gain valuable insights into the leadership potential and capabilities of employees at all levels. This information can then be used to identify high-potential individuals, provide targeted development opportunities, and groom them for future leadership roles.

In addition to these benefits, conducting an employee 360 survey can also help to improve communication and relationships within the organization. By providing a platform for feedback and discussion, businesses can address misunderstandings, resolve conflicts, and build stronger relationships between employees and teams. This can lead to a more cohesive and collaborative work environment where everyone is working towards a common goal.
